Comprehending Car Keys
Car keys have evolved considerably for many years. What when was a basic metal key has transformed into complex devices equipped with sophisticated innovation. There are a number of kinds of car keys, including:
Traditional Key: The classic metal key that by hand runs the vehicle locks and ignition.Transponder Key: A key with a microchip that interacts with the vehicle’s ignition system, supplying included security.Key Fob: A remote that enables keyless entry and often ignition start.Smart Key: A sophisticated keyless entry system that doesn’t need the physical insertion of a key into the ignition.Valet Key: A minimal access key that permits short-lived gain access to without the full performance of the main key.The Need for Replacement

Picking a Car Key Replacement Service
Choosing the right car key replacement service can conserve you both money and time. Here are a number of aspects to think about:
1. Kind Of Key Needed
Understanding what type of key your vehicle requires is the very first action. Some replacement keys may be simple and affordable, while others may require advanced technological intervention.
2. Service Availability
Some services operate 24/7, providing roadside support and emergency services. Consider selecting a company who can help you outside standard business hours.
3. Cost of Service
The cost of changing car keys can vary commonly based upon the type of key and the company. It is suggested to get quotes from several sources. An overview of prospective costs is supplied below:
Type of KeyTypical CostStandard Key₤ 2 - ₤ 10Transponder Key₤ 30 - ₤ 75Key Fob₤ 50 - ₤ 100Smart Key₤ 150 - ₤ 350Valet Key₤ 10 - ₤ 204. Credibility of the Service Provider
Constantly inspect consumer reviews and scores to assess the dependability and efficiency of a replacement service. Word of mouth and online testimonials can supply valuable insights.
5. Proximity
Picking a service that neighbors can lower the waiting time for your replacement.
6. Guarantee and Guarantees
Inquire whether the service provider offers any guarantees or warranties on their work. A reliable service may use a return policy in case the changed key does not work correctly.
The Process of Replacement
When seeking a car key replacement, comprehending the actions included can help you navigate the process smoothly. Here is a brief summary of the replacement procedure:
Gather Necessary Information
VIN (Vehicle Identification Number)Proof of Ownership (registration or title)Identification (chauffeur’s license)
Contact a Replacement Service
Discuss your needs and the kind of key required.Confirm service schedule and approximated costs.
Go To the Service Provider
Take your vehicle if required.Supply the needed paperwork.
Wait for the Key to Be Made
Depending on the intricacy, the replacement process may take anywhere from a couple of minutes to a number of hours.
Test the Key
Ensure that the new key runs efficiently and can lock/unlock the vehicle and start the engine.Preventive Measures

Q: Can I replace my car key myself?A: While some easy
keys can be duplicated at home, many sophisticated keys, especially transponder and smart keys, require expert equipment and programming. Q: How long does it take to change a car
key?A: Depending on the type of key and the schedule of
needed programming tools, the procedure can take anywhere from a couple of minutes to several hours. Q: Do I require my vehicle to change the key?A: In the majority of cases, having
your vehicle is essential, especially for programming transponder keys or smart keys. Q: Will my car key replacement include programming?A: Most professional services will consist of programming for transponder keys and smart keys in the cost of the service.
